Fix error code for too small input buffer to getnameinfo

 2011-12-22  Ulrich Drepper  <drepper@gmail.com>
 
+	[BZ #13166]
+	* inet/getnameinfo.c (getnameinfo): Return EAI_OVERFLOW if the
+	buffer for the output is too small.
